Each year every company must submit an annual return, also known as a 363, to confirm the details of the company shareholders. The company secretary usually takes care of this however if you choose our company secretarial service we will file this return on your behalf.

Composites and MSCs (managed service companies) are no longer legal in the UK and umbrella companies offer higher risk and lower tax efficiency than limited company operation.
